About this vintage design furniture

Chandelier designed by Terence Conran and manufactured by Erco lightening manufacture in 1970’s period, Germany. This piece is made of steel and chrome lightening "eye balls"with in chrome-plated half-rings all around, revolving balls inside and black plastic frame around them. This piece is a well-known design that is well documented in general design literature, design museums etc. This vintage item has no defects, but it may show slight traces of use. Lamps are tested and in wording condition.

About the designer

Terence CONRAN

Terence Conran was a British designer and entrepreneur, often considered one of the pioneers of modern design and interior design. Although he is British, his influence also extends to France, thanks to his many projects and collaborations with French brands and companies.
